Is it recommended to operate the drill at full RPM when drilling into composite material?

Operating the drill at full RPM when drilling into composite materials is generally not recommended, making the assertion that it is true misleading. When working with composites, it's crucial to consider factors such as heat generation, material integrity, and the type of composite being drilled.

Composite materials can be sensitive to high temperatures and may suffer from delamination or fiber distortion if overheated. Drilling at lower speeds often produces less heat, which helps maintain the integrity of the composite and reduces the risk of damaging it. It also allows for better chip removal, which is essential to avoid clogging the drill bit and ensuring cleaner holes.

The optimal drilling speed can vary depending on the specific type of composite material and the drill bit being used. Therefore, a more nuanced approach to drilling speed is necessary to achieve the best results without compromising the material's properties.

Understanding these nuances is essential for anyone engaged in aerospace assembly or maintenance involving composite materials, ensuring safer and more effective practices.
